SD-WAN troubleshooting

Refer to the exhibit.

Question Image

An administrator is troubleshooting SD-WAN on FortiGate. A device behind branch1_fgt sends traffic to the 10.0.0.0/8 network.

The administrator expects the traffic to match SD-WAN rule ID 1 and be routed through HUB1-VPN1. However, the traffic is routed through HUB1-VPN3.

Based on the output in the exhibit, which two reasons, separately or together, could account for the observed behavior?

Choose two
  • A HUB1-VPN3 has a lower route priority value (higher priority) than HUB1-VPN1.
  • B HUB1-VPN3 has a higher member configuration priority than HUB1-VPN1.
  • C The traffic matches a regular policy route configured with HUB1-VPN3 as the outgoing device.
  • D HUB1-VPN1 does not have a valid route to the destination.
Explanation

A lower route-priority value is preferred, and the routing table shows the 10.0.0.0/8 static route through HUB1-VPN3 with priority 10. SD-WAN also selects a member only when that member has a valid route to the particular destination. The displayed HUB1-VPN1 BGP routes are for other, more-specific prefixes, so HUB1-VPN1 may have no valid route for the relevant address within 10.0.0.0/8.
